Trumpet Vine

Trumpet Vine is a large, fast-growing climbing vine with pinnate glossy dark green leaves that are a duller green underneath and turn yellow in fall.  It's trumpet-shaped flowers come in bright shades of orange and reds and bloom on new growth, attracting bees and butterflies from summer until frost.  Blooms best in full sun and well-drained soil.  An excellent choice for trellises or pergolas.  Very aggressive spreader and drought tolerant.

Type: 

Perennial, Vine

Origins:

Eastern N. America; GA Native

Height:

30’ - 40’

Spread: 

6’ - 10’

Spacing: 

8’

USDA Hardiness Zone: 

4 - 9

Culture: 

Full Sun 

Bloom Color: 

Orange/Red

Season of Interest: 

SummerFall 

MAINTENANCE NEEDS:  High maintenance.  Prune in early spring before flowering.  Needs sturdy support, as the plant gets heavy.  The biggest problem is restraining the suckers to prevent self-seeding and smothering nearby plants.

LANDSCAPE USES:  Specimen or Mass Plantings, ScreeningWater Gardens or PondsWildlife Garden, Trellises and Walls, and Containers.

COMPANION PLANTS: Bee BalmMilkweedButterfly Bush
